Your responsibilities
As a Senior Procurement Specialist, your main responsibility is to play a key role in managing the end-to-end Source to Contract process. In this role you will be instrumental to supporting the Global Category Managers and Category Leaders with implementing Sourcing strategies to ensure successful deliver against category targets. Working effectively with the Global Category Teams, you will advise on and drive the global sourcing strategies through the effective application of the Source to Contract process. You will direct the preparation and delivery of each key element of the end to end sourcing and contracting process. Influence best practice, standardization and ensure compliance across the lifecycle of the source to contract process.
